Define meiosis, mitosis, and heredity
Korvikt [17]

Meiosis: A type of cell division that results in four daughter cells each with half the number of chromosomes of the parent cell, as in the production of gametes and plant spores.

<span>Mitosis:<span> A type of cell division that results in two daughter cells each having the same number and kind of chromosomes as the parent nucleus, typical of ordinary tissue growth.</span></span>

<span>Heredity: T<span>he passing on of physical or mental characteristics genetically from one generation to another.</span></span>

The work done by dr. rose ann cattolico and her assistants at the university of washington involves _______.
sergeinik [125]
The question above is incomplete, the options attached to the question are as follows:
A. extracting chlorophyll from algae to learn how these organisms gain energy from light.
 B. engineering vehicles that use algae for fuel.
C. growing algae under different conditions and measuring their lipid production.
 D. engineering algae to photosynthesize at higher rates.

ANSWER
The correct option is C.
 Dr. Rose and her assistants set out to carry out scientific investigation that will identify living organisms that can grow rapidly and that will produce high quality lipids at the same time. The team had hypothesized that this type of organisms will be good candidates for production of bio fuels. The group concentrated on working with algae; these were grown under different conditions and their lipid contents were assessed. Their work has led to identification of many algae species as potential sources of bio fuel. <span /><span>
